For extreme heat, we use materials with high thermal stability. Our powder-coated aluminum benches reflect sunlight and resist heat absorption, while our specially treated hardwoods contain natural oils that prevent drying and cracking. The bench components are designed with expansion joints to accommodate material expansion during heatwaves without warping.
In freezing temperatures, our benches utilize frost-resistant materials that won't become brittle. The powder coating on metal benches provides a protective barrier against moisture infiltration that could freeze and cause damage. For wooden options, we use dense hardwoods with closed-cell structures that resist water penetration and subsequent freeze-thaw damage.
All our benches undergo rigorous testing in climate chambers that simulate temperature extremes from -30°F to 120°F (-34°C to 49°C). We subject them to rapid temperature changes to ensure the materials and joints maintain integrity. The hardware is always stainless steel or similarly corrosion-resistant to prevent rust in all conditions.
Proper maintenance enhances longevity. We recommend occasional cleaning and, for wooden benches, applying a protective sealant annually. With these design features and simple care, our benches provide comfortable, reliable seating through seasonal extremes, year after year.
